NO FURTHER action is to be taken against a man who was arrested on suspicion of assault, burglary and criminal damage after police attended an address.
Officers were called to an address on Princess Avenue, Windlehurst on the afternoon of Thursday, March 25 shortly before 2pm to a report of a concern for safety.
Police arrested a 29-year-old man who was taken into custody.

After the arrest, a Merseyside Police spokesman had said: "We can confirm that a man was arrested following a domestic incident in St Helens yesterday, Thursday, March 26.
"At around 1.50pm, officers were called to an address in Princess Avenue to reports of a concern for safety.
"A 29-year-man from St Helens was detained and has been arrested on suspicion of burglary; criminal damage; and common assault."
Merseyside Police have confirmed that the man has been released with no further action to be taken.
